The Rohingya, considered the most persecuted minority in the world, have fled Myanmar into Bangladesh due to a military-led terror campaign. Almost a million stateless people now live in makeshift refugee camps, relying entirely on humanitarian aid. The film "One Life" follows eight-year-old Nur Kalima as she adapts to life in the world's largest refugee camp.
